About 18 Frances Street
18 Frances Street is an end-of-terrace house in Brinsley, Nottingham, Nottingham (NG16 5BP). It has a recorded floor area of 105 m² (around 1130 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(May 2015) shows an E (score 45),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 79),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from May 2015,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Held since August 2004 — that's 22 years off the open market, well above the local norm. Today's modelled estimate of £165,000 sits 94.1% above the 2004 sale of £85,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£75/sq ft) was about 26.3% below the postcode norm. At 105 m² it's 28% larger than the typical home in the postcode (82 m² median across 13 EPCs).
